Black children deserve better than the lies and partial truths that are often taught in U.S. schools. So what do we teach them, and how do we teach them? Dr. Joshua M. Myers, an associate professor of Africana Studies at Howard University and author of the forthcoming book "Cedric Robinson: The Time of the Black Radical Tradition," joins the ladies for What's On Your Heart? in this episode on education.
